Explanatory Note

(This note is not part of the Order)

This Order, made in accordance with section 58(2) of the Local Government Act 1972, gives effect to proposals of the Local Government Boundary Commission for Wales (“the Commission”), which reported in July 2007 on a review of communities conducted by Powys County Council. The Commission’s report recommended changes to the existing boundaries of communities within the area of Powys County Council and consequential changes to electoral arrangements, and this Order gives effect to the Commission’s recommendations without modification.

The effect of this Order is that there are changes to a number of community areas and consequential changes in electoral arrangements. Further, the communities of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ant (in the former district of Glyndwr) and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ant (in the former district of Montgomeryshire) are amalgamated and constitute the new community of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ant which will be represented by 11 community councillors. Transitional and consequential provision is made in respect of the new community council. Consequential provision is made in respect of the electoral divisions of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ant/Llansilin and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ant. The electoral division of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ant/Llansilin will comprise the communities of Llangedwyn and Llansilin and the new community of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ant and will continue to have one county councillor. The electoral division of Llanrhaeadr-ym-Mochnant is to be known as Llanwddyn and will comprise the communities of Llangynog, Llanwddyn and Pen-y-Bont-Fawr and will continue to have one county councillor.

Prints of the boundary maps A to N are deposited and may be inspected during normal office hours at the offices of Powys County Council, Llandrindod Wells, Powys and at the offices of the Welsh Assembly Government at Cathays Park, Cardiff (Local Government Policy Division).

The Local Government Area Changes Regulations 1976 referred to in article 2 of this Order contain incidental, consequential, transitional and supplementary provision about the effect and implementation of orders such as this.
